Kafka确实拥有极高的吞吐量,每秒钟可处理百万级别的消息。
在本文中,我们就从Kafka底层原理的角度,盘点出若干个高吞吐量的原因。
批处理机制在Kafka的内部实现中,无论是生产者发送消息给Broker,还是Broker将消息落盘持久化,以及消费者从Broker上拉取消息,都是以批处理的方式进行的。
这是Kafka实现高吞吐量的核心设计之一。
1、生产者端Kafka生产者端有一个非常重要的参数, batch.size,默认值为16384字节,16KB。
该参数…。
{dede:pagebreak/}
Node.js是谁发明的?
哪个瞬间让你觉得编程只是一门技术?
脸与身材不符是种怎样的体验?
贵州榕江县城遭超 30 年一遇洪水威胁,最大商场被洪水淹没,目前当地情况如何?为什么此次洪水这么大?
如何看出一个人有没有管理能力?
作为一个服务器,node.js 是性能最高的吗?
太空中没有氧气,为什么太阳还在燃烧?
想要入行音***开发,但是没有相关项目经验怎么办?
我国为什么没有类似CIA和克格勃的对外情报机构?
为什么这么久了还是没有主流软件开发鸿蒙版?
为什么很多知乎的回答推崇日本式的市区、市郊通勤铁路?
如何看待现在的前端?
现代艺术只考虑意义、不考虑美感吗?
可以随身携带一个Linux系统吗?
住顶楼,经常有户人家上来晒被子,说了好多次不听,怎么办?
请问27寸4K显示器哪个好呀?